First of all, you should know that if you hire a babysitter, even for just one hour a year, she immediately becomes your employee. This means that she works for you and that you are legally obliged to declare her. Don’t panic, if you are lost in the administrative procedures or if you don’t know the French system, you should know that declaring your babysitter is not very complicated and can allow you to benefit from some interesting subsidies.

Why declare my babysitter?

When you think of hiring a babysitter, you immediately think of your little neighbour, a high school student, who can look after your children on Friday evenings during your Zumba class for a few euros an hour. Even if this idea may be attractive at first glance, this solution deprives you of many social benefits.

  • Being in accordance with the law

And yes! Even if the idea seemed interesting, employing someone without prior declaration is illegal and carries legal sanctions. And as a little extra, the minimum age to be able to work normally in France is 16 (conditionally from 14/15 years old).

  • Being insured

Because no one is safe from a small accident, declaring the person who looks after your children allows you to be covered. Indeed, if an accident occurs during working hours, the insurance will be able to cover various expenses such as hospital costs.

  • Reassurance

By using a registered babysitter, you are more likely to find someone you can trust, who is experienced and will be able to provide your children with everything they need in your absence.

Use the CESU to declare your babysitter

The CESU or Chèque Emploi Service Universel will allow you to pay your babysitter while simplifying the procedures. The CESU was set up to help private employers who need services such as gardening, home cleaning and especially childcare.

Why use CESU?

As previously mentioned, the CESU allows you to simplify all your administrative procedures, but that’s not all:

  • You allow your babysitter to contribute to the various social security funds
  • You can call on your insurance if necessary
  • Membership is simple and quick, as are the declarations
  • You can deduct 50% of the amount of your babysitting expenses as a tax reduction or credit

How to use CESU?

Obtaining a chequebook is very simple. All you have to do is go to the website cesu.ursaf.fr to sign up. Once you have done this, you must declare the hours worked by your babysitter and the net amount of his or her salary each month. The charges will be automatically deducted from your bank account.

Please note that if your babysitter works on a regular basis, i.e. for more than 8 hours a week or for more than 4 consecutive weeks a year, you will be obliged to draw up a parent-employer employment contract. This document must include

  • the identity of both parties,
  • the date of employment,
  • the place of work (often your home),
  • the conditions of employment with the hours of work, days and details of the tasks performed…,
  • the duration of the trial period,
  • the remuneration.

Finally, the pre-financed CESU is offered by the employer, the mutual insurance company or any co-financing organisation. These vouchers can be used to pay your babysitter directly.

PAJE

The Prestation d’Accueil du Jeune Enfant (PAJE) is an aid that helps pay for certain expenses for children under 6 years of age. How does it work? It is very simple!

  • First of all, you have to declare your babysitter
  • You can reduce the cost thanks to certain aids such as the Caf
  • Finally, you can benefit from a 50% tax credit reduction on the cost of your babysitting
